These symptoms might include fatigue, muscle weakness, poor coordination, difficulty multitasking, loss of sensation, poor balance, pain, and/or difficulty with speech and swallowing. These symptoms may be impacting everyday activities and having an impact on your quality of life.
All patients have a comprehensive assessment by relevant members of our multidisciplinary team – which includes physiotherapists, exercise physiologists, speech pathologists, dietitians and occupational therapists. We then work with you to develop a tailored rehabilitation program that’s tailored to your particular needs and goals.
A specialist rehabilitation for people with neurological conditions or injuries
This program is suitable for people who:
- have recently had a stroke
- are living with a chronic neurological condition and have had a recent illness or injury associated with that condition
- have recently been diagnosed with a new neurological condition such as multiple sclerosis (MS) or motor neurone disease (MND) and need management and support
- have Parkinson’s disease and associated difficulties with mobility or activity of daily living
